Loan Options and Strategies to Manage Student Debt

Federal Student Loan Programs

The primary source of federal student aid for students attending Mississippi Delta Community College is the Federal Pell Grant and federal student loans, including Direct Subsidized and Unsubsidized Loans. These loans typically feature lower interest rates and flexible repayment options compared to private loans, making them a preferred choice.

  • Direct Subsidized Loans: Available to students demonstrating financial need. The government pays the interest while students are enrolled at least half-time, reducing overall debt accumulation.
  • Direct Unsubsidized Loans: Not need-based; interest accrues from disbursement. Students can choose to pay the interest during school or capitalize it into the principal.

Private Student Loans

Private loans from banks or credit unions may be necessary if federal aid does not fully cover tuition and expenses. These often come with higher interest rates and less flexible repayment terms. Students should carefully compare options and consider private loans only after exhausting federal aid.

Strategies for Managing Student Debt

  • Borrow Only What You Need: Minimize debt by borrowing strictly for tuition, books, and essential living expenses.
  • Understand Repayment Plans: Familiarize yourself with income-driven repayment plans, such as Income-Based Repayment (IBR) or Pay As You Earn (PAYE), which can make monthly payments more manageable.
  • Explore Loan Forgiveness Programs: Certain careers, especially in public service or technical fields, may qualify for loan forgiveness programs.
  • Maintain Good Financial Habits: Budget wisely during school and after graduation to ensure timely payments and avoid default.
  • Seek Financial Counseling: Utilize resources available through the college or federal programs to plan your debt repayment strategy effectively.

Program Overview and What Students Will Study

Program Description

The Electrical Engineering Technologies/Technicians program at Mississippi Delta Community College is designed to prepare students for technical roles in electrical systems, instrumentation, and automation. The program emphasizes hands-on training combined with theoretical knowledge, equipping students with practical skills to meet industry demands.

Curriculum Highlights

Students will study a broad range of subjects including electrical circuitry, electronics, digital systems, control systems, programmable logic controllers (PLCs), electrical code compliance, and troubleshooting techniques. The curriculum balances classroom instruction with laboratory work, ensuring students gain real-world experience.

Learning Outcomes

Graduates will be competent in installing, maintaining, and repairing electrical systems, interpreting electrical diagrams, and working safely in diverse industrial environments. They will also develop problem-solving skills, technical communication, and teamwork abilities essential for career success.

Career Opportunities and Job Prospects

Employment Sectors

Graduates of this program are well-positioned for employment across various sectors, including manufacturing, construction, utilities, telecommunications, and automation industries. The demand for skilled electrical technicians continues to grow with advancements in technology and infrastructure development.

Job Titles and Roles

  • Electrical Technician
  • Industrial Maintenance Technician
  • Electronics Installer
  • Control Systems Technician
  • Automation Technician

Salary Expectations

While specific median salaries for this particular program are not provided, according to the U.S. Bureau of Labor Statistics, electrical and electronics installers and repairers earn median wages around $60,000 annually, with opportunities for higher earnings based on experience and specialization.

Financial Information: Tuition, Debt, and Return on Investment

Tuition Costs

The in-state tuition at Mississippi Delta Community College is $3,540 per year, while out-of-state students pay $6,140. Additional costs include fees, books, supplies, and living expenses, which should be factored into total financial planning.

Student Debt and Repayment

Since the median student debt data for this program is not available, students should focus on borrowing responsibly. With federal loans, repayment typically begins six months after graduation or leaving school. Effective planning can mitigate long-term debt burdens.

Return on Investment (ROI)

Considering the relatively low tuition costs and strong job prospects in the electrical sector, the ROI for this program can be favorable. Graduates can enter the workforce sooner and with less debt compared to four-year degree programs, leading to earlier financial independence.
